The e-way bill will by June become a regular occurrence for most movements of goods within India. Unlike a GST compliant invoice which must be issued when there is a supply; an e-way bill is released before the movement of the products. When that is considered the number of e-way bills is significant, and the threshold for issuance is a value higher than 50,000 and a movement greater than 10 km. Initially on 1 April 2018, the e-way bill was only to be issued for inter-state movement and intra-state movement in Karnataka but by 1 June 2018 it will be for all movements inter-state and intra-state except for five locations: Andaman and Nicobar, Chandigarh, Dadra and Nagar Haveli, Daman and Diu and Lakshadweep. By the 20th of April, a total of 12 states will require the e-way bill to be implemented for intra-state trade. E way bill is a document required to be carried by a person in charge of the conveyance carrying any consignment of goods of value exceeding fifty thousand rupees mandated by the government in terms of section 68 of the GST Act read with rule 138 of the rules framed there under. Generate e way bill : Eway bill is generated from the NIC portal by the registered persons or transporters who cause movement of goods/consignment before the commencement of such movement. One must remember that even if you have registered in NIC portal, you need to register again on the e way bill portal. Consolidated e way bill: It is a document comprising of multiple e-way bills for multiple consignments being carried in one transport vehicle. The transporter, carrying multiple consignments of various consignors and consignees in one vehicle can generate e way bill and carry a consolidated one instead of carrying multiple e-way bills for those consignments. What is an E-Way Bill, how to generate an E-Way Bill ? What is an E -Way Bill? An E- Way Bill is an electronically generated document with a unique number allotted to a specific shipment from a vendor whose shipment value is more than 50,000 INR. The E- Way Bill needs to be generated before the shipment starts its journey from the source, this is made mandatory by the government & is going to be implemented from the 1st of February, 2018. The generated document needs to be carried by the person in charge of the shipment for checking and verifications purpose during the transportation. The key benefit is that the Cross verification of bills will be easy due to single format across India unlike earlier, where each state government prescribed its own format. As an acknowledgement that the taxpayer has paid tax for the movement of goods an e-Waybill is essential for monitoring, the same needs to be produced when a government official request for it during the transportation. Though there is a centralized system now earlier it was never the case! Every individual state had its own way bill concepts with its own formats and policies. State government officials reported that there are high chances of producing duplicate waybill in many cases and there were many operational challenges while issuing/ delivering the way bills. Consolidated e way bill is one of the biggest advantages of e way bill implementation. Earlier, transportation & logistic trucks/vehicles used to carry invoices for different products with different way bills. Instead of carrying separate document for each consignment the process is enhanced by introducing consolidate e way bill. Government intends to improve the verification efficiency while simultaneously tightening the shipment compliance. Under the e way bill law, user can actually generate a single document for multiple invoices/ shipments in the form of consolidated e way bill. Each consignment will receive a separate EBN (e-way bill Number) which is a unique identifier for a particular consignment. All those EBN’s can be consolidated to generate a single e way bill instead of the individual e way bill documents. How to generate a consolidated e-way bill? With multiple implementation and operational challenges, GST Council has decided to postpone the e-way bill implementation date probably to last week of February. The execution dates initially thought were June 2018 for interstate goods movement & February 2018 for intrastate goods movement. With the acceptance of 15+ states, e way bill was initially rolled out across India but suffered major technical setbacks. The e-way bill portal and offline utility is open for trial until further notice for both inter and intrastate movement of goods. So far there is no clear communication about the effective date and it is expected that the new date of launch will be announced in the next couple of weeks. Users of more than 17 states accessing and trying to generate several e way bills at the same time led to technical glitches as the servers couldn’t accommodate the transaction volume.
